Output d0b53a91f60e3ef3a9951c53ba2d99a7f286b06243128c9d4895dbcbb76f5701:6

value
41983547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c3ff4e8307211e2cfa6b961deca7a3798adf61 OP_EQUAL
address
MCFinaQaKemLAgdKiDbNxrzqBWLHad6EYZ
transaction
d0b53a91f60e3ef3a9951c53ba2d99a7f286b06243128c9d4895dbcbb76f5701
spent
true